In
today's world of solar powered cars and kinetic energy powered wrist
watches, you'd think that there would be a mass movement away from inefficient high energy products. And you'd be right. But
something else is happening as the mainstream moves to reduce their
carbon footprints, and that is the emergence of increasingly popular
'niche' products. Things like the WMK A-16, or as it's otherwise known
the Apollo Steam Shower. It's not the most
efficient use of water and energy, but it is cool, and very expensive,
and there seems to be an increasing number of wealthy families who are
willing to pay the exorbitant prices for this sort of stuff. Priced at about US$21,000, which is about A$14,600, the Apollo
Steam Shower will probably impress your house guests with its unique
look than it will with any of its features. It's enclosed in a
futuristic 'space capsule' with one rounded side that houses a
seat for users who run out of steam (pun intended). It also has its own lighting system, and once inside users can expect a range of relaxing water delivery systems: Steam Generator (3,000 Watt Steam Generator with Digital Timer) Hydrotherapy Foot Massager (Foot Massage with WMK Foot Scrub System) 6 Acupuncture Body Massage Jets Hands Free System Volume Control (WMK Microphone) Ozone Sterilization Function
As
well as the steam system (one of the reasons the Steam Shower is
completely enclosed) and foot massager and all the other features,
the Apollo Steam Shower also comes with useful
waterproof stereo inputs and a range of other buttons and levers
to play with. Like steam rooms you'd find at a gym or fitness
centre or hotel, steam showers cleanse the pores of toxins by allowing
you to sweat out the gunk. Unlike sauna's, which use dry heat to relax
the body and cleanse it, steam showers use wet heat. If
Australia wasn't engulfed in one of the worst droughts to afflict
this country, the dryest continent on Earth, perhaps something like the
Apollo Steam Shower would be considered a viable
and indeed relaxing alternative to the standard shower. Or maybe
